When we talk about traffic poles, it's important to recognize that they come in several types, designed for specific functions. The most common types include signal poles, sign poles, and light poles.
Signal poles are primarily used to support traffic lights and signals, regulating the flow of vehicles at intersections. They are typically designed to withstand harsh weather conditions and heavy usage, often constructed from durable materials like steel or aluminum.
Sign poles, on the other hand, carry road signs that inform or instruct drivers and pedestrians. These could include speed limit signs, directional signs, or warning signs indicating potential hazards. Sign poles are usually positioned for maximum visibility and are available in various heights and designs to ensure they meet road safety standards.
Light poles, which are often seen alongside streets and highways, provide illumination for nighttime driving. Adequate lighting enhances visibility, helping to reduce accidents and improve security for pedestrians and drivers alike. In recent years, many cities have begun installing energy-efficient LED light poles, thus promoting sustainable urban practices.
Traffic poles serve a variety of critical functions that contribute to road safety and efficient traffic flow. Their primary purpose, of course, is to convey important information to road users. However, their utility goes beyond mere communication.
One significant use of traffic poles is to support advanced technological devices, such as traffic cameras and motion detectors. These devices monitor real-time traffic conditions, potentially allowing for quicker responses to accidents or congestion. The integration of traffic poles with smart technology can also facilitate data collection, helping city planners make informed decisions about infrastructure improvements.

Furthermore, the placement of traffic poles plays a vital role in pedestrian safety. Poles often mark crosswalks and help designate safe walking paths, ensuring that pedestrians can navigate busy streets without unnecessary risk. In this way, traffic poles not only enhance vehicular safety but also prioritize pedestrian needs.
Understanding the regulations governing traffic poles is essential for anyone involved in urban development or road safety initiatives. Various local and national standards dictate how and where traffic poles may be installed, ensuring they meet safety requirements.
For example, the placement and height of traffic poles are often regulated to avoid obstructing sightlines for drivers and pedestrians. Moreover, the reflectivity of signs and signals attached to these poles is typically governed by specific guidelines to ensure visibility under different lighting conditions.
Additionally, regular inspections and maintenance are mandated to ensure that traffic poles remain functional and safe. Failures in pole maintenance can lead to accidents or injuries, underlining the importance of adhering to regulations.
